> In 'top' what is the command "httpd"?  Are those page requests that are
> getting serviced or what?

httpd is your web server. in the apache conf file, you can specify how many
child servers can be run.

apache isn't multithread (V2.0 will be). i'm not sure exactly how this works,
but spawning other apache processes allows it to handle multiples requests.
